Per Aaron's Rule #0, no agent or skill ships to the AWS box unless its test passes locally first. - `test/paperclip-knowtation-skills.test.mjs` — unit tests for the 5 skills - `test/paperclip-agent-fixtures.test.mjs` — fixture tests for the 7 agent prompts - `test/paperclip-bridges.test.mjs` — mocked API tests for HeyGen, ElevenLabs, Descript Run: `pnpm test paperclip` ## Secrets, never committed The Terraform creates an SSM Parameter Store namespace at `/knowtation/paperclip/*`. Every secret lives there: - `/knowtation/paperclip/DEEPINFRA_API_KEY` - `/knowtation/paperclip/HEYGEN_API_KEY` - `/knowtation/paperclip/HEYGEN_AVATAR_ID` - `/knowtation/paperclip/HEYGEN_VOICE_ID` - `/knowtation/paperclip/ELEVENLABS_API_KEY` - `/knowtation/paperclip/ELEVENLABS_VOICE_ID` - `/knowtation/paperclip/DESCRIPT_API_KEY` - `/knowtation/paperclip/DESCRIPT_BORNFREE_PROJECT_ID` - `/knowtation/paperclip/DESCRIPT_STOREFREE_PROJECT_ID` - `/knowtation/paperclip/DESCRIPT_KNOWTATION_PROJECT_ID` - `/knowtation/paperclip/KNOWTATION_HUB_URL` - `/knowtation/paperclip/KNOWTATION_HUB_JWT` - `/knowtation/paperclip/KNOWTATION_VAULT_ID` The EC2 instance has an IAM role with read-only access to this namespace. Paperclip's systemd service reads the parameters at startup and re-reads them every 60 seconds (so JWT rotation is hot — no restart required). ## Costs | Resource | Monthly cost | |----------|--------------| | EC2 t3.medium (2 vCPU, 4 GB RAM) | $30.37 | | EBS gp3 30 GB | $2.40 | | SSM Parameter Store (Standard) | $0.00 (free tier covers 10k params) | | Data egress | <$1 (mostly inbound webhook traffic) | | **Total AWS** | **~$33/mo** | This is the orchestration layer only.
